Where is the Hubener family from?

You can see how Hubener families moved over time by selecting different census years. The Hubener family name was found in the USA, the UK, and Canada between 1880 and 1920. The most Hubener families were found in USA in 1880. In 1891 there were 2 Hubener families living in Hampshire. This was about 67% of all the recorded Hubener's in United Kingdom. Hampshire had the highest population of Hubener families in 1891.

What did your Hubener ancestors do for a living?

In 1940, Farmer and Maid were the top reported jobs for men and women in the USA named Hubener. 30% of Hubener men worked as a Farmer and 34% of Hubener women worked as a Maid. Some less common occupations for Americans named Hubener were Clerk and School Teacher.

What is the average Hubener lifespan?

Between 1965 and 2004, in the United States, Hubener life expectancy was at its lowest point in 1987, and highest in 2003. The average life expectancy for Hubener in 1965 was 72, and 57 in 2004.

An unusually short lifespan might indicate that your Hubener ancestors lived in harsh conditions. A short lifespan might also indicate health problems that were once prevalent in your family.
